Nicolai Theodorius Nilssen Rygg was a Norwegian economist and Governor of the Central Bank of Norway.

2.

Nicolai Rygg was born in Stavanger as a son of shoemaker Ole Nilssen Rygg and Ane Severine Larsdatter.

3.

Nicolai Rygg was a brother of journalist Andreas Nilsen Rygg.

Nicolai Rygg was a deputy judge in Vesteralen District Court before studying economics in Gottingen and Geneve in 1896 to 1897, later statistics in the United States from 1904 to 1905.

6.

Nicolai Rygg worked in Statistics Norway from 1898, and from 1907 he doubled as secretary in Statistics Norway and research fellow at the Royal Frederick University.

7.

Nicolai Rygg was regarded as an active financial politician, and as being a more independent bank governor than his successors.

8.

Nicolai Rygg is known for pressuring opposition leader Johan Ludwig Mowinckel to file a vote of no confidence against the socialist Hornsrud's Cabinet in February 1928.

Nicolai Rygg was a fellow of the Norwegian Academy of Science and Letters.

11.

Nicolai Rygg was decorated as a Knight Grand Cross of the Order of the Polar Star and the Order of the White Rose of Finland, and Commander of the Order of St Olav, the Order of the Dannebrog, the Order of Vasa, the Order of the Falcon and the Order of the Nile.
